Trust and transparency

Editorial policy

Nocturnal Devs publishes Cat Groomers USA to help readers make a more informed grooming inquiry. Our editorial standard is useful, attributed information—not a target number of pages.

Original work, shared design

Pages share navigation and a consistent layout so readers can compare them. Their individual editorial notes are written for the actual business and source material; other qualified records organize specific sourced fields, missing information, and local comparisons. We do not swap city names into general advice or pad listings with interchangeable booking paragraphs.

What we will not claim

We do not present a scrape as an inspection, a credential as a quality guarantee, a customer testimonial as verified service evidence, or a listed price as your final quote. Missing evidence stays missing. We distinguish mixed-pet rooms, cat-only spaces, and house-call services only when the sources support that distinction.

Review and corrections

Research can use AI-assisted extraction and drafting. Searchable records show attributed factual details and useful comparison routes. Profiles with an individual editorial review add a source-specific brief, date, and practical question. Records that fail the evidence and depth checks are excluded from recommendations. Owners and readers can request corrections or removals without payment through our contact page.

Commercial independence

There is no paid directory ranking. Any future display advertising is separate from editorial selection and must follow the advertising disclosure. Source businesses are not automatically partners, endorsers, or sponsors of this website.

Care and image limits

Guides are educational, not veterinary advice. We do not recommend medication, sedation, or treatment plans. Generated cat illustrations are decorative and labeled; they are not photographs proving a business’s facilities or work.
